
The Borromean Island On Lake Maggiore In Italy
Information
Title
The Borromean Island On Lake Maggiore In Italy
Artist
Ludwig Bemelmans
Medium
Digital Art - Digital Art
Description
Publication: House & Garden
Image Type: Illustration
Date: January 1st, 1939
Description: An illustration of the Borromean Island on Lake Maggiore in Italy.
Uploaded
March 9th, 2017
Embed
Share
Image ID
CN00151282